Output d107ed3c71f12a9e10b661431425e377befa0a7054191c8e82a9037751ab75db:4

value
50690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b7b4c96ef10acc9fb119150a09a9928c488af00 OP_EQUAL
address
32jj4dYqRyDTxNsc49aYTYnAakNa3pbzof
transaction
d107ed3c71f12a9e10b661431425e377befa0a7054191c8e82a9037751ab75db
spent
true